About the Academy

narta logo
training class

NARTA is a regional training center serving city, county and state law enforcement agencies throughout the state of Arizona. It is housed at Yavapai College, Prescott Valley Business and Career Center in Prescott Valley, Arizona. The Defensive Tactics, Drivers and Firearms Training, and Stop and Approach are held at off-campus locations

The basic training program at NARTA encompasses 680-hours (a 17-week course) and includes:

  • Intoxilyzer 5000
  • Impaired Driver Detection
  • Horizontal Gaze Nystagmus Training

Mission

"Northern Arizona Regional Training Academy is dedicated to provide the highest quality of basic law enforcement training to the diverse law enforcement agencies throughout the state of Arizona, through effective instruction and leadership."

Philosophy

The basic training program is designed to introduce recruits to law enforcement work. The training provided will be demanding, as is the job of law enforcement. The experience at NARTA will challenge you mentally, physically, and academically, while at the same time, lay a foundation for advanced training. In order to assure the best possible chance of future success, attention to detail, individual responsibility, self discipline, autonomy, and teamwork, amongst other qualities will be stressed and required. The academy staff will provide a positive, professional environment for recruits so they may acquire needed knowledge, develop necessary physical skills, and become confident in their ability to become successful peace officers.
